Abstract
A high frequency line-waveguide converter comprises a high frequency line including a dielectric layer, a line conductor disposed on an upper surface of the dielectric layer, and a ground conductor layer disposed on the same surface so as to surround one end of the line conductor, a slot formed in the ground conductor layer so as to be substantially orthogonal to the one end of the line conductor and coupled to the line conductor, a shield conductor part disposed on a side of or in an inside of the dielectric layer so as to surround the one end of the line conductor and the slot, and a waveguide disposed at the lower side of the dielectric layer so that an opening is made opposite to the one end of the line conductor and the slot, and electrically connected to the shield conductor part.
